Course Hero is an American education technology website company based in Redwood City, California which operates an online “pay-to-use” learning platform for students to access course-specific study resources. A subscription is required for students to use the platform.

The crowdsourced learning platform contains practice problems, study guides, infographics, class notes, step-by-step explanations, essays, lab reports, videos, user-submitted questions paired with answers from tutors, and original materials created and uploaded by educators. Users either buy a subscription or upload original documents to receive unlocks that are used to view and download full Unblur Course Hero Content documents.

Course Hero was founded by Andrew Grauer at Cornell University in 2006 for college students to share lectures, class notes, exams, and assignments. In November 2014, the company raised $15 million in Series A Funding, with investors that included GSV Capital and IDG Capital. Seed investors SV Angel and Maveron also participated.

In February 2020, the company raised a further $10 million in Series B Funding, valuing the company at over $1 billion. The Series B round was led by NewView Capital, whose founder and managing partner, Ravi Viswanathan, joined Course Hero’s board of directors. NewView Capital also contributed $30 million in what’s known as an employee tender offer, a process by which NewView purchased company shares directly from Course Hero employees.

Method 1: Use Your Free Course Hero Account

Unblur Course Hero Content monthly subscriptions range from approximately $10 to $40. Unfortunately, not everyone has the resources to pay for a monthly plan, especially if they have a tight budget. But you can also use the website to sign up for a free account if you don’t already have one.

A free Course Hero profile offers fewer perks and restricts your access to most materials. However, there are tricks to unblur restricted content and study more efficiently. These include uploading original documents, reviewing uploaded materials, and creating quizzes.

Option 1: Upload Documents using your Free Account

Upload using Windows PC

Unblur Course Hero Content is dedicated to connecting learners with valuable information and has a free unlocking system. After uploading the original study documents, the platform grants you access to other materials for free. For every ten uploads, Course Hero rewards you with five unlocks. Using your Windows PC or Mac, you can upload materials to the learning platform.

Here’s what you need to do to upload files to Course Hero on a Windows computer:

  • Head to the “Course Hero“ web page and log into your free account. You can also register for one.
  • Find and select the blurred document you want to access.
  • Click on the pink “View Full Document” button.
  • Press the “Continue to Access” button.
  • Course Hero now displays the subscription options that unlock the file. Navigate to the bottom of the page and select the “Upload Your Study Document” option.
  • Press the “Desktop” button and select the documents you want to upload to the site.

It may take to Unblur Course Hero Content up to 24 hours to analyze and process your uploads. Once the process completes, the platform will credit your account, allowing you to unblur five study materials. You can revisit the upload page if the 24-hour processing period has elapsed and you still haven’t received your five free study materials.

The platform marks each successful upload as “Accepted.” Unsuccessful submissions appear as “Decline: Duplicate.” The site only accepts original content, and its system eliminates study materials already added. Always submit original notes to ensure all your uploads go through smoothly.

Option #2. Review Study Materials using Your Free Account

Reviewing materials is another way you can access restricted content on Course Hero. The site values users’ feedback and uses it to assess how helpful the available resources are. Even with a free account, you can view many unlocked materials.  After assessing or rating five papers, you can unblur one answer or document. It’s a handy solution when you feel uncertain about sharing your notes with others.

Option #3. Create a Quiz using Your Free Account

The site offers another unlocking hack. Creating quizzes is relatively quick and allows you to see more hidden answers and materials. Before making a quiz, you must unlock at least three documents.  You can meet this requirement by uploading original notes or reviewing uploaded resources. When making a quiz, ensure it adheres to the site’s regulations. The more people that respond to the quiz, the more unlocks you’ll obtain.
